RODEO X22SE 2.2L ENGINE DRIVEABILITY AND EMISSION
DIAGNOSTIC TROUBLE CODE (DTC) P1546 A/C COMPRESSOR CLUTCH
OUTPUT CIRCUIT MALFUNCTION
D06RX037
Circuit Description
The Powertrain Control Module (PCM) controls the A/C
Compressor Clutch Solenoid through the use of a relay
and a control (ground) circuit. If the PCM commands the
A/C Compressor Clutch Solenoid ON but the voltage
remains High (12 volts) or, if the PCM commands the A/C
Compressor Clutch Solenoid OFF but the voltage
remains Low (0 volts), then DTC P1546 will set. DTC
P1546 is a type D code.
Conditions for Setting the DTC
f
Ignition voltage is greater than 10 volts.
f
Engine run time is greater than 32 seconds.
The above mentioned conditions are met and one of the
following two conditions are met for 25 seconds within a
50 second test sample.
f
PCM senses voltage is High with the A/C Compressor
Clutch Solenoid commanded ON.
OR
f
PCM senses voltage is Low with the A/C Compressor
Clutch Solenoid commanded OFF.
Action Taken When the DTC Sets
f
The PCM will not illuminate the Malfunction Indicator
Lamp (MIL).
f
The PCM will store the conditions that were present
when the DTC was set as Freeze Frame and in Failure
Records.
Conditions for Clearing the DTC
f
A history DTC will clear after 40 consecutive trips
without a reported failure.
f
The DTC can be cleared using the Scan Tool’s ”Clear
Info” function.
Diagnostic Aids
f
Poor connections, or a damaged harness – Inspect the
harness connectors for: backed–out terminals,
improper mating or damaged terminals. Also check for
open circuits, shorts to ground, and shorts to voltage.

RODEO X22SE 2.2L ENGINE DRIVEABILITY AND EMISSION
Diagnostic Trouble Code (DTC) P1625 PCM Unexpected Reset
014RX002
Circuit Description
The powertrain control module (PCM) monitors
unexpected PCM reset. This will not turn on MIL light on,
only records code DTC P1625.
Conditions for Setting the DTC
f
Clock or COP (Computer Operating Properly) reset.
Action Taken When the DTC Sets
f
The PCM will not illuminate the malfunction indicator
lamp (MIL).
f
The PCM will store conditions which were present
when the DTC was set as Failure Records only. This
information will not be stored as Freeze Frame data.
Conditions for Clearing the DTC
f
The PCM will turn the MIL “OFF” on the third
consecutive trip cycle during which the diagnostic has
been run and the fault condition is no longer present.
f
A history DTC P1625 will clear after 40 consecutive
warm-up cycles have occurred without a fault.
f
DTC P1625 can be cleared by using the Tech 2 “Clear
Info” function or by disconnecting the PCM battery
feed.
Diagnostic Aids
Check for the following conditions:
f
P1625 alone stored does not need diagnosis. Clear
DTC code.
NOTE: DTC P1625 is a DTC to record a PCM reset
history. If DTC P1625 is not reset and no engine
abnormality is found after clearance of DTC, it is not
necessary to do any farther processing.
